Title: Annoying red circles on route
Post by: hendo on October 13, 2011, 00:23:41
Hi folks
When I import a route I have created, it shows up fine, but there are annoying red circles, which must indicate points, which is a distraction. Is there anyway to hide them and just show the route.

Regards
Title: Re: Annoying red circles on route
Post by: Menion on October 13, 2011, 07:17:37
Hi Hendo,
  if you see on all points red dot, it's because you define this in GPX file. If you look on GPX description http://www.topografix.com/GPX/1/1/#type_rteType (http://www.topografix.com/GPX/1/1/#type_rteType), you can see that rte tag is defined as rte represents route - an ordered list of waypoints representing a series of turn points leading to a destination. and trk as trk represents a track - an ordered list of points describing a path., so you have to change rte to trk to see only track without these dots
